Innovation in Spinal Surgery
The patented invention introduces a highly specialized reduction system for treating spondylolisthesis, a condition where a vertebra slips out of its proper position onto the bone below it. Traditional correction often requires invasive open surgeries that can destabilize surrounding bony structures. This new system provides a minimally invasive mechanical approach utilizing a specified bracket, threaded rods, and tightening knobs. The rods are guided through the bracket openings into the affected vertebral segments. By adjusting the knobs against the bracket, surgeons can precisely pull and reposition the displaced vertebra into its correct anatomical alignment. Once the vertebra is accurately reduced, an interspinous implant can be securely placed to promote fusion. This methodology represents a substantial technical improvement over prior surgical techniques by minimizing surgical trauma while ensuring precise biomechanical control.
